Coromandel Beach Properties Rising in Value – Climate Change Warnings Ignored

Denis from Thames

Coromandel coastal property values are surging by as much as 66 percent, new research by OneRoof shows. Despite a slowdown in sales volumes since 2015 and ever more strident warnings from official and industry sources of an increased threat from climate change, coastal properties are still rising in value – and in many cases becoming more up market.
